What Is Compound Interest?
Compound interest is the process where the value of an investment increases because the earnings on an investment, both capital gains and interest, earn interest as time passes. In simpler terms, you earn interest on your interest.
This creates a snowball effect where your money grows at an increasing rate over time. The longer you leave your money invested, the more dramatic the growth becomes due to the compounding effect.
The Compound Interest Formula
The standard formula for calculating compound interest is:
A = P(1 + r/n)nt
Where:
- A = the future value of the investment/loan, including interest
- P = the principal investment amount (the initial deposit or loan amount)
- r = the annual interest rate (decimal)
- n = the number of times that interest is compounded per year
- t = the time the money is invested or borrowed for, in years
Why Compounding Frequency Matters
The frequency at which interest is compounded significantly impacts your final balance. More frequent compounding periods (daily vs. annually) will yield higher returns, all else being equal.
| Compounding Frequency | Formula Representation (n) | Example with $10,000 at 5% for 10 Years |
|---|---|---|
| Annually | 1 | $16,288.95 |
| Semi-annually | 2 | $16,386.16 |
| Quarterly | 4 | $16,436.19 |
| Monthly | 12 | $16,470.09 |
| Daily | 365 | $16,486.65 |
As you can see, the difference between annual and daily compounding on a $10,000 investment over 10 years at 5% interest is nearly $200. While this may seem small, the difference becomes much more significant with larger principal amounts and longer time horizons.
The Rule of 72: A Quick Way to Estimate Doubling Time
The Rule of 72 is a simple way to estimate how long it will take to double your money at a given annual rate of return. Simply divide 72 by the annual interest rate:
Years to Double = 72 ÷ Interest Rate
For example, if you’re earning 8% annually, your money will double in approximately 9 years (72 ÷ 8 = 9).
| Interest Rate | Years to Double (Rule of 72) | Actual Years to Double |
|---|---|---|
| 4% | 18 | 17.7 |
| 6% | 12 | 11.9 |
| 8% | 9 | 9.0 |
| 10% | 7.2 | 7.3 |
| 12% | 6 | 6.1 |
The Rule of 72 is remarkably accurate for interest rates between 6% and 10%. For rates outside this range, you might use the Rule of 70 or 73 for slightly better accuracy, but the Rule of 72 remains the most commonly used version due to its many divisors.

Advanced Compound Interest Concepts
For those who want to dive deeper, here are some advanced concepts:
- Continuous Compounding: This is the mathematical limit of compounding frequency. The formula becomes A = Pert, where e is the mathematical constant approximately equal to 2.71828.
- Effective Annual Rate (EAR): This adjusts the nominal interest rate for compounding periods. EAR = (1 + r/n)n – 1.
- Present Value: This is the current worth of a future sum of money given a specific rate of return. The formula is PV = FV/(1 + r/n)nt.
- Inflation-Adjusted Returns: Real returns account for inflation. The formula is (1 + nominal return)/(1 + inflation rate) – 1.

Compound Interest vs. Simple Interest
It’s important to understand the difference between compound and simple interest:
| Feature | Compound Interest | Simple Interest |
|---|---|---|
| Definition | Interest earned on both principal and accumulated interest | Interest earned only on the original principal |
| Growth Rate | Exponential (accelerates over time) | Linear (constant growth) |
| Formula | A = P(1 + r/n)nt | A = P(1 + rt) |
| Common Uses | Investments, retirement accounts, most loans | Some bonds, certain short-term loans |
| Long-Term Effect | Significantly higher returns over time | Lower returns compared to compound interest |
For example, with $10,000 at 5% interest for 10 years:
- Compound interest (annually): $16,288.95
- Simple interest: $15,000.00
The difference becomes even more dramatic over longer periods.
How to Calculate Compound Interest Manually
While calculators are convenient, understanding how to calculate compound interest manually is valuable:
- Convert the annual rate to periodic rate: Divide the annual rate by the number of compounding periods per year.
- Calculate the number of periods: Multiply the number of years by the compounding periods per year.
- Apply the formula: Use A = P(1 + r/n)nt with your values.
- Calculate the total: The result is your future value.
Example: $5,000 at 6% compounded monthly for 5 years:
- Periodic rate = 6%/12 = 0.005 (0.5%)
- Number of periods = 5 × 12 = 60
- A = 5000(1 + 0.005)60 = 5000(1.34885) = $6,744.27

Compound Interest and Inflation
Inflation is the silent enemy of compound interest. Here’s how to think about it:
- Nominal vs. Real Returns: Nominal returns don’t account for inflation; real returns do.
- Rule of 72 for Inflation: At 3% inflation, your money loses half its purchasing power in about 24 years (72 ÷ 3).
- Inflation-Protected Securities: TIPS (Treasury Inflation-Protected Securities) adjust for inflation, preserving your purchasing power.
- Historical Inflation Rates: In the U.S., long-term average inflation is about 3.22% annually.
- Real Rate of Return: Subtract inflation from your nominal return to get the real return.
For example, if your investment returns 7% but inflation is 3%, your real return is only 4%. This is why it’s crucial to consider inflation when planning for long-term goals.

Compound Interest and the Time Value of Money
Compound interest is closely related to the time value of money (TVM) concept, which states that money available today is worth more than the same amount in the future due to its potential earning capacity. Key TVM concepts related to compounding:
- Present Value (PV): The current worth of a future sum of money given a specific rate of return.
- Future Value (FV): The value of a current asset at a future date based on an assumed rate of growth (compounding).
- Annuities: A series of equal payments made at equal intervals, whose value is calculated using compound interest principles.
- Perpetuities: Annuities that continue forever, whose value is calculated using a variation of the compound interest formula.
The formulas for these concepts are all variations of the compound interest formula, adjusted for different scenarios.

Compound Interest and Student Loans
Understanding compounding is crucial for managing student loan debt:
- Capitalization: When unpaid interest is added to the principal, increasing the amount that future interest is calculated on.
- Subsidized vs. Unsubsidized Loans: Subsidized loans don’t accrue interest while in school, preventing compounding during that period.
- Income-Driven Repayment Plans: Can lead to negative amortization where unpaid interest is added to the principal, increasing compounding.
- Refinancing: Can change the interest rate and compounding terms of student loans.
- Loan Forgiveness Programs: May affect strategies for paying down compounding student loan debt.
Being strategic about student loan repayment can save thousands in compounded interest.

Compound Interest and Credit Cards
Credit cards often use compounding to maximize what you owe:
- Daily Compounding: Most credit cards compound interest daily, leading to rapid debt growth.
- Minimum Payments: Often cover little more than the compounded interest, keeping you in debt.
- Grace Periods: Paying in full each month avoids compounding interest charges.
- Balance Transfers: Can temporarily pause compounding, but often with transfer fees.
- Cash Advances: Typically start compounding interest immediately with no grace period.
Understanding credit card compounding can help you avoid costly debt traps.
